Brief History of Eswatini

A Brief History of Eswatini offers an insightful exploration into the history of one of Africa's last remaining monarchies, a small but dynamic country that has navigated the complexities of tradition, colonialism, and modernity.

From its early days as the homeland of the Nguni-speaking people to its emergence as a kingdom under the leadership of the Swazi monarchy, this book delves into Eswatini's rich cultural heritage...
